Question
Suppose bar(n) is an O(n) function that returns n. What is the big-oh runtime of the following function?
int foo(int n)
int i, sum = 1;
for (i = e; i « bar(n); i++)
sum += bar(n);
return sum;
View transcribed image text
Expand

Expert Answer

Want to see the step-by-step answer?

Check out a sample Q&A here.

Want to see this answer and more?

Experts are waiting 24/7 to provide step-by-step solutions in as fast as 30 minutes!*

*Response times may vary by subject and question complexity. Median response time is 34 minutes for paid subscribers and may be longer for promotional offers.
Tagged in
Engineering
Computer Science

Boolean Logic

Related Computer Science Q&A

Find answers to questions asked by students like you.

Q: a) By how much is the total execution time changed if the time for class D is reduced by 20% and the...

A: It examines execution time as a result of three factors that are generally distinct of one another. ...

Q: what are problems associated with redundancy?

A:   Redundancy is the duplication of data or the storing of the same data in more than one place. Redu...

Q: 1. How many different Vignere keys of length 4 are there for coding the English alphabet? The last s...

A: The encryption of alphabetical text is done via the method of Vigenere Cipher Poly alphabetic replac...

Q: Let L = {aibjck | i, j, k ≥ 0 and if i = 1 then j=k}. a. Show that L is not regular using closure p...

A: Introduction A regular language can be conveyed with the help of a regular expression. They are ack...

Q: 8. Show that the following hypothesis lead to the conclusion "If I do not finish writing the program...

A: Step 1:- Introduction:- The proposition is defined as a statement that can be either true or false. ...

Q: Allow the user to enter the names of several local businesses. Sort the business names and display t...

A: There are four method defined in the program , they are swap Stringsort print_strings main Swap wi...

Q: What type of security was dominant in the early years of computing

A: Computing: The process of using computer or computer technology to complete a task is known comput...

Q: Which methodology, Agile or waterfall, do you think is most appropriate for a project characterized ...

A: Appropriate methodology for a project characterized by innovation The requirements are not properly...

Q: q in pic

A: (i) a'b (a' + c) + ab'(b' + c) = a'ba' + a'bc + ab'b' + ab'c = a'b + a'bc + ab' + ab'c (using a.a = ...

Q: Using C++, A contact list is a place where you can store a specific contact with other associated in...

A: Below is the required C++ program: - Approach: - Import the essential headers and use the namespace...

Q: 工。 A function named pFile() is to receive a filenarme as a reference to an ilstream object. What dec...

A: Objective: We need to mention the declaration for the function pFile() having a parameter as a refer...

Q: Design and draw an ER diagram that captures the information about the university. Consider thefollow...

A: Click to see the answer

Q: Java Programming: Practice your class design and development process by creating 2 classes based on...

A: Objective: We need to define two classes Home and Address with the necessary details.  Programming l...

Q: How do computers read code?

A:   We write a program or code using any high level programming language for a particular task, the co...

Q: Hello, I have a few questions in regards to SQL Server. It was answered on the website before, but w...

A: Stored procedures: A procedure is a collection of procedural and SQL statements. A procedure may h...

Q: Write a function called reversit () that reverses a C-string (an array of char). Use a forloop that ...

A: The program will ask for the input string and store in a variable. The string will be passed to meth...

Q: CSMA/CA and CSMA/CD explain the purpose each of these, for what type of network it is used. Explain ...

A: CSMA/CA : Carrier Sense Multiple Access / Collision Avoidance. It is using in wifi communication.  I...

Q: Answer the following question for basic sorting algorithms. Here is an array of 7 integers: (1)   ...

A: Part (1): The selection sort algorithm sorts any array by repeatedly finding the minimum element fr...

Q: GLSC01-Artificial Intellegence : WHAT ARE THE P (PERFORMANCE MEASURES), E (ENVIRONMENTS), A (ACTUATO...

A: PEAS in Artificial intelligence PEAS is an acronym (or short notation) for "Performance measure, Env...

Q: Write multiple if statements: If carYear is before 1967, print "Probably has few safety features." (...

A: 1. Taking User input for the carYear variable. 2. Writing multiple if statements as per given condit...

Q: A bank's customer records are to be stored in a file and read into a set of arrays so that a custome...

A: â€¢¢ Include the header files iostream for input-output operation, fstream for file operations, cstd...

Q: Discuss the reasons of home and business users create a network. Identify how networks facilitate th...

A: REASON OF HOME AND BUSINESS USER TO CREATE THE NETWORK: The most important reason to create the hom...

Q: Highlight five typical operations that file systems allow users or applications to carry out on file...

A: Basic file operations that file systems permit users or applications to carry out on files are as fo...

Q: Assume these definitions:int n1 = 4, n2 = 5, n3 = 30;double d1 = 3.0, d2 = 10.0;Please enter the num...

A: Generally, inputs are provided as data values and then calculations are performed on these data valu...

Q: Your program will read in "game scores" from the user. Each score consists of a score for YOUR team ...

A: The Program effectively uses the 2D arrays to strore and retrieve values from. When user enters opti...

Q: Set hasDigit to true if the 3-character passCode contains a digit.

A: Programming approach Here, we will use the built-in method isDigit() to determine whether a characte...

Q: Convert Each octal number into hexadecimal 17.5 256.47 145.1 With steps please

A: Click to see the answer

Q: An employee’s total weekly pay equals the hourly wage multiplied by the total number of regular hour...

A: STEPS - Declare  variables to calculate total weekly pay. Take input from user named with wages per ...

Q: Create a text file named car.dat containing the following data (without theheadings):Car Number Mile...

A: A required C++ program is as follows, File name: “main.cpp” //Include header files #include <iost...

Q: Is technology by itself enough to ensure high quality customer service?

A: Yes technology by itself enough to ensure high-quality customer service because Customer service is ...

Q: In one project, it is required to define cubes whose compressive strength limits 20-30 mpa. Accordin...

A: Program approach: Define the program name. Declare do loop between limits 20-30. Prints results and...

Q: Suppose in an implementation of STACK supports an instruction REVERSE which reverses the order of th...

A: Stacks are based on the LIFO(Last In First Out) principle, i.e., the element inserted at the last, i...

Q: Write a c++ program to determine how many times a character is contained in a string. You are requir...

A: Introduction of Program The program accepts both a sentence and a character from the user and output...

Q: An employee’s total weekly pay equals the hourly wage multiplied by the total number of regular hour...

A: PROGRAM: #Getting input for hourly wage hourlyWage = int(input("Enter the hourly wage: "))   #Gettin...

Q: Complete the given Car class with set, get,and display functions as well as a constructor that accep...

A: The following instructions are needed to write the program for the class Car: Include the header fi...

Q: Implement the following functions using Decoder.F(A,B,C,D,E)=∑(0,1,5,15,24,25,27)+ d(2,4,20,21,22,29...

A: Step 1:- F(A,B,C,D,E)=∑(0,1,5,15,24,25,27)+ d(2,4,20,21,22,29) This expression in the Sop form is re...

Q: I need Help again understanding C++ programming with a  problem: Assume an equation is in the form: ...

A: EXPLANATION: Given formula is “ax+b=c”, to compute the value of x, formulate the given formula to f...

Q: Write answer with explaination

A: From the above C code, we are supposed to tell how many times "Hello, World" will be printed.

Q: Problem 1 (Ransom Note Problem) in python A kidnapper kidnaps you and writes a ransom note. He does ...

A: Program code: def ransom_note(magazine, ransom):     hash_words = {}     # Create the hash tabled wi...

Q: Determine whether the given pair of graphs is isomorphic. Exhibit an isomorphism or provide a rigoro...

A: Isomorphic graph:  Isomorphic graph is a a graph that can exist in different forms having the same n...

Q: Briefly describe the common classes of OS intruders

A: Step 1:-   Introduction:-   In a computer system when any person who wants to cause some trouble for...

Q: Explain the Linux Virtual File System concept and describe the four object types of the file system.

A: Linux Virtual File System: - It is the layer of software within the kernel that provides user-space ...

Q: Suppose in an implementation of STACK supports an instruction REVERSE which reverses the order of th...

A: A linear structure where activities happen with some specific operations are known as stack. The ope...

Q: Define a python function ‘australian_tennis(d)’ which reads a dictionary of the following form and i...

A: Program code: #method to find the highest scorer    def australian_tennis(test_list):    highScore =...

Q: Using only Pseudocode how will I write any given time period in minutes, convert to hours and minute...

A: Note: Below is the required program in the python language. Program: '''taking input from the user''...

Q: How Can I Write a python program that displays a table of inches from 1-12 and equivalent lengths in...

A: Introduction of Program This python program displays a table of length in inches and equivalent leng...

Q: In cell 9, enter a formula to calculate the sum of the current assets in the range B6:B9

A: SUM formula in Excel The SUM function is of the arithmetic formula used in Excel to compute sum(or ...

Q: Suppose in an implementation of STACK supports an instruction REVERSE which reverses the order of th...

A: Given statement (a) is False. According to question,  A Queue cannot be implemented using this modif...

Q: Assign secretID with firstName, a space, and lastName. Ex: If firstName is Barry and lastName is All...

A: Combining strings in Java In java, the build-in concat() method is useful for combining two strings ...

Q: ((A – B – C) U (B – A – C) U (C – A – B) – (AN B N C)

A: Click to see the answer

Transcribed Image Text

Suppose bar(n) is an O(n) function that returns n. What is the big-oh runtime of the following function? int foo(int n) int i, sum = 1; for (i = e; i « bar(n); i++) sum += bar(n); return sum;